Wash Post – Joe Miller poised to take Senate seat from Alaska’s Lisa Murkowski
Results on Wednesday showed Joe Miller holding a slim lead of about 1,900 votes over Murkowski, but a winner might not be declared until election officials count as many as 10,000 absentee ballots, which could take several days.
